Meeting notes, Orbit Scheduler migration. Agreed: all cron jobs on the legacy Thornvale boxes move to the Driftwheel workflow engine by end of quarter. Secrets move from crontab env vars to the vault integration; no plaintext credentials in job definitions. Legacy boxes decommissioned two weeks after cutover. Audit logging enabled per job. Rollback plan documented in the runbook. Security sign-off required from:

account owner for bawip-tahag: Raleth Quenok

Handover Note — Training Budget FY Next

To the heads of department: the provisional training budget holds flat at last year's level, with a 6% carve-out reserved for the Merrow certification track. Unspent Q1 allocations will not roll forward. Darla Quince has the vendor shortlist; approvals above the threshold go through her office until the transition completes. One planning detail follows for your eyes only.

internal memo for hahaf-kahof: Only 39 of the 428 pilot accounts renewed Sorion, so a churn review is set for April 12. Praokix Freight is in early talks to buy Queniusox Group for about $145.8 million.

Finance Review Summary — Board Copy

Quarterly cash-flow forecast for Tannervale Group: operating inflows projected at modest growth, driven by the Merrow contract renewals. Outflows elevated due to tooling spend at the Halbrick site. Net position turns positive in month two; headroom against the facility remains adequate but thin. Key risks: receivables slippage from Drossen Retail and FX movement on Eastbrook purchases. No covenant concerns at present. Planned responses are detailed in the note below.

board note of bawep-tajef: Queniusek Systems plans to raise the Quenvan list price by 53.1 percent in March. The pricing group signed off on a budget of $176.4 million for Project Drueth. The renewal with Casionix Partners closes at $142.5 million a year, 8.3 percent below the last contract. Project Fraax slips by six weeks because of the tooling delay.